PART B ( DESCRIPTION OF DESIGNATED PROJECT)

Title of Designated Project(s)

«ü©w¤uµ{¶µ¥Øªº¦WºÙ

Natural Terrain Hazard Mitigation Works at Study Area 11NE-B/SA3, Razor Hill, Clear Water Bay Road

[This designated project is hereinafter referred to as "the Project"]

Nature of Designated Project(s)

«ü©w¤uµ{¶µ¥Øªº©Ê½è

 

Mitigate potential landslide hazards arising from the natural terrain by implementing natural terrain hazard mitigation measures within a conservation area above Clear Water Bay Road

Location of Designated Project(s)

«ü©w¤uµ{¶µ¥Øªº¦aÂI        

The Project is located at Razord Hill along Clear Water Bay Road, Sai Kung. The location of this Project is shown in Figure 1 attached to this Permit.

Scale and Scope of Designated Project(s)

«ü©w¤uµ{¶µ¥Øªº³W¼Ò©M½d³ò

 

The total works area is approximately 24,700m2 and the project comprises:-

(a)  installation of about 845 nos. soil nails with 1 - 2m spacing and 0.15m in diameters at the western portion of the works area;

(b)  provision of 4-6m high flexible barriers and maintenance staircases;

(c)  installation of about 168 nos. anchors for flexible barriers; and

(d)  landscaping works.

 

The scope of works is shown in Figure 2 of this Permit. The full details are given in the Project Profile (Register No.: PP-565/2018).

2.         Specific Conditions

2.1                The Permit Holder shall not carry out any work outside the boundary of works areas as indicated in Figure 2 of this Permit or otherwise agreed by the Director.

2.2              The Permit Holder shall implement all measures described in the Project Profile (No. PP-565/2018) submitted with the application on 28 February 2018.

2.3              The Permit Holder shall submit to the Director for approval, at least 6 weeks before commencement of construction, 3 sets of a Detailed Baseline Survey Report showing the updated number, locations and conditions of all plant species of conservation importance and existing trees within the works areas.

2.4              The Permit Holder shall submit to the Director for approval, at least 6 weeks before commencement of construction, three sets of a Detailed Landscape Mitigation Plan showing the details of protective measures for existing plants, trees and root systems during construction. The Detailed Landscape Mitigation Plan shall also indicate with the aid of figures, re-vegetation by native shrubs, and locations of re-vegetation of the existing disturbed ground including other suitable areas within the works area. The Permit Holder shall implement all measures recommended in the approved Detailed Landscape Mitigation Plan during construction.

2.5              The Permit Holder shall submit to the Director for deposit, three hard copies and one electronic copy of the monthly monitoring reports showing the updated conditions of the plant species of conservation importance within the works areas and site audit information for implementation of the measures recommended in the Project Profile within two weeks after the relevant monitoring data are collected.

2.6              An independent environmental checker (IEC) shall be employed by the Permit Holder before commencement of construction of the Project. The IEC shall not be in any way an associated body of the Contractor for the Project. The IEC shall audit the implementation of all measures recommended in the Project Profile (Register No. PP-565/2018), and to certify in writing in the monthly monitoring reports for full implementation of the measures during and upon completion of the construction works. The final monitoring report should include a summary with photos to illustrate the condition of all the plant species of conservation importance before commencement and upon completion of the construction works.
